Investing.com -- Yanolja, a global travel technology company, has formed a strategic partnership with Google (NASDAQ:GOOGL) Cloud to enhance its AI-driven services for the travel industry.
Two companies said that the collaboration aims to personalize traveler experiences and increase operational efficiency for business clients in the travel sector.
The partnership will see Yanolja integrate Google Cloud’s advanced AI infrastructure, training, and inference tools into its platform.
Leveraging Google Cloud’s technology with Yanolja’s extensive travel data, the company plans to offer hyper-personalized travel experiences and automated operations for travel enterprises globally.
"Yanolja will rapidly advance the enhancement of its innovative AI technology for global travelers and travel enterprises through its partnership with Google Cloud," Junyoung Lee, Chief Technology Officer at Yanolja Group, commented.
The South Korea-based company is also enhancing its enterprise solutions with initiatives like cloud-based auto check-in/check-out kiosks and AI-powered customer communications, expecting to increase the accuracy and efficiency of these operations with Google Cloud’s support.
Overall, the partnership is a part of the company’s broader strategy to transform the global travel industry through innovative AI technology.
"We’re excited to partner with Yanolja, combining our cutting-edge technology with their deep data expertise and vertical AI, to drive transformative innovation within the global travel market," Karan Bajwa, President of Google Cloud Asia-Pacific, added.
